Comprehensive Geological Environment Technology in Mining Area
The development of mining leads to many bad effects. The surface vegetation is badly destroyed due to subsidence. The paper gives an introduction to geological environment problems related with mining, such as subsidence, waste rock hills, water loss, soil erosion and quarry ruin. At the same time, the ecological problems have also been resulted into threaten normal living and working surroundings. To solve the above-mentioned problems many investigations have been done, however previous studies have failed to cope with the real geological situation, thus further studies are still necessary. Taking Xishan mining area as an example, comprehensive measures are discussed to permanently deal with things concerning village relation, geological park construction and geological environment restoration. By setting up technology models, the real control ways are provided. In order to echo to Taiyuan Municipal Government's plan, new ideas are put forward by constructing a suburban ecological tourist area featured with ecological conservation, mine relics exhibition and mountain sightseeing, By discussing the comprehensive technology models, the old development model of "solutionafter pollution", will be abandoned and two sorts of treatment are proposed, which are characterized by friendly environment and safe coal production. The result of the study will be a good reference for treating the similar problems in other mining area like Xishan mining area.
